Johnson County staff recommend $1.15 million Stantec contract for 2D floodplain modeling of Captain and Kill Creek watershed
Summary
Public Works presented a recommended contract with Stantec to produce two-dimensional floodplain models for the Captain and Kill Creek watershed (watershed organization 5). Total contract is $1,151,989 with a county cost share of $198,819; funding comes from a FEMA grant and the adopted 2025 stormwater management program budget.
Johnson County Public Works staff on Jan. 9 asked the Board of County Commissioners to authorize a contract with Stantec to develop a two-dimensional floodplain model for the Captain and Kill Creek watershed at a total cost not to exceed $1,151,989.
